Transcription factor and microRNA regulation in androgen-dependent and -independent prostate cancer cells
BACKGROUND: Prostate cancer is one of the leading causes of cancer death in men. Androgen ablation, the most commonly-used therapy for progressive prostate cancer, is ineffective once the cancer cells become androgen-independent.
